Navigating the Perils of the Highway: Core Gameplay Mechanics

At its heart, the gameplay of this type of game is built upon precise timing and pattern recognition. The relentless flow of traffic demands constant attention and quick decision-making. Players aren't simply reacting to individual cars; they're anticipating gaps, predicting vehicle speeds, and adjusting their chicken’s movements accordingly. Successful navigation requires a nuanced understanding of the game's physics and a steady hand. The initial stages may seem deceptively easy, lulling players into a false sense of security. However, as the game progresses, the speed of the traffic increases, new vehicle types are introduced, and the gaps between cars become smaller and less predictable. The intensity ramps up quickly, transforming a casual pastime into a true test of reflexes and focus. This escalating difficulty is a key element in maintaining player engagement.

The Role of Power-Ups in Strategic Advancement

While dodging traffic is the primary objective, the strategic collection of power-ups adds another dimension to the gameplay. These power-ups provide temporary advantages, such as invincibility, increased speed, or the ability to slow down time. Utilizing power-ups effectively can significantly improve a player’s chances of survival, allowing them to navigate particularly challenging sections of the road or recover from a near miss. The placement of power-ups often requires players to take calculated risks, venturing slightly closer to danger in order to secure a valuable boost. Mastering the timing of power-up acquisition and deployment is crucial for achieving high scores and progressing further into the game. Effective power-up management turns a game of pure reaction into one of thoughtful decision-making.

Power-Up Effect Duration
Invincibility Grants temporary immunity to collisions. 5 seconds
Speed Boost Increases the chicken's movement speed. 3 seconds
Slow Time Reduces the speed of traffic. 4 seconds
Magnet Attracts nearby coins and bonus items. 5 seconds

The use of different power-ups can truly alter the flow of the game. Learning when to use each one is vital for success. A smart player will know that a Speed Boost is best used in the early game to quickly collect coins, while Invincibility should be saved for particularly difficult sequences.

The Psychological Hooks: Why We Keep Playing

The addictive nature of this genre stems from a combination of psychological principles. The constant challenge, coupled with the immediate feedback of success or failure, creates a strong sense of engagement. Each attempt feels like a learning experience, encouraging players to refine their timing and strategy. The incremental progress, as players unlock new levels or achieve higher scores, provides a sense of accomplishment and motivates them to continue playing. Furthermore, the short gameplay sessions make it easy to fit a quick game into even the busiest schedules. This combination of factors creates a powerful loop that keeps players hooked. The desire to beat your own high score or to surpass the scores of friends and rivals adds another layer of motivation.

  • Immediate Feedback: Players instantly know if they’ve succeeded or failed.
  • Incremental Progress: Unlocking new content provides a sense of achievement.
  • Short Session Length: Easy to pick up and play during short breaks.
  • Social Competition: Competing with friends enhances motivation.

These psychological elements are carefully woven into the design of the game, contributing to its enduring popularity. The desire for continued improvement and the thrill of overcoming challenges, however humble, contribute to a surprisingly deep and rewarding experience.
